Look Outside
Look Outside drops you into a single apartment building after something’s gone horribly wrong. One glance out a window turns people into grotesque monsters, and now you’re stuck scavenging corridors for food, supplies, and makeshift weapons just to get through another day.
It balances the scary bits with quiet downtime. You’ll head out on tense expeditions to fight your way through over 150 hand-crafted creatures in turn-based combat that actually cares about positioning, then drag your loot back home to cook dinner, craft tools, and slowly get to know the strange neighbours you’ve recruited along the way.
It’s a small, weird game with a proper nasty body horror aesthetic and a cast of characters who range from oddly charming to properly unhinged. With 10 to 12 hours of playtime, a dozen boss fights, and several different endings depending on who you save and what you uncover, there’s a lot packed into one building.
